ZIP 76692 is home to 9,853 people in Hill County. The median age is 50.9, about 12 years above the US median. 82% of homes are owner-occupied. Four-year degrees are less common here than nationally, at 21% of adults. The typical home is worth $169,100. Getting to work takes 36 minutes on average. Among the 14 ZIP codes in Hill County, 76692 ranks 12th by median household income.
How many people live in ZIP code 76692?
ZIP code 76692 has about 9,853 residents according to the 2024 American Community Survey.
What is the median household income in ZIP code 76692?
The typical household in ZIP code 76692 earns about $55,149 a year. Half of households make more than that, and half make less.
Is ZIP code 76692 expensive?
In ZIP code 76692, the median home is worth about $169,100, and the typical rent is about $877 a month.
How educated are people in ZIP code 76692?
About 21.5% of adults age 25 and over in ZIP code 76692 hold a bachelor's degree or higher.
What is the poverty rate in ZIP code 76692?
About 16.8% of people in ZIP code 76692 live below the federal poverty line.
